Commit graph

67 commits

Author SHA1 Message Date
tron
15a1806057 Stop this package from findind "pkg-config" and trying to use libraries
which it shouldn't use. An installed "glib2" package might otherwise
cause build failures.
2002-09-11 15:13:02 +00:00
wiz
80ee491886 Since the major of libiconv was increased during the update to 1.8,
bump dependency to latest libiconv version; recursively also bump all
dependencies of packages depending on libiconv.
Requested by fredb.
2002-09-10 16:06:32 +00:00
jlam
e2afa97f51 Merge changes in packages from the buildlink2 branch that have
buildlink2.mk files back into the main trunk.  This provides sufficient
buildlink2 infrastructure to start merging other packages from the
buildlink2 branch that have already been converted to use the buildlink2
framework.
2002-08-25 18:38:05 +00:00
tron
6740c2c8a5 Fix broken Linux include file hack which causes build failure on
NetBSD-current.
2002-08-16 12:21:53 +00:00
jdolecek
98894b3276 update checksum for patch-bt 2002-08-15 09:28:14 +00:00
skrll
651d33b081 Make sure we require the new version of kdelibs 2002-08-15 08:48:08 +00:00
skrll
3652e0b5ce Bring in security fix for certificate handling.
PKGREVISION++
2002-08-15 08:38:33 +00:00
cjep
2ea9005980 Mark this package as broken on arm32. Compilation hangs the machine even
without optimization. XXX Should probably try using gcc>=2.95.3.
2002-05-20 10:16:36 +00:00
dmcmahill
00a89aba55 turn off optimization on alpha to workaround a c++ compiler bug. 2002-04-10 12:30:23 +00:00
dmcmahill
cf4557c286 obey CXXFLAGS and don't unconditionally prepend -O2. 2002-04-10 12:27:33 +00:00
jmc
da80eab055 Include KDED_WORKAROUND as without it the PLIST_SUBST is kinda pointless (and
it then breaks package builds).
2002-03-31 08:15:08 +00:00
skrll
ae7898d267 Do the kded fix differently.
Don't mess with startkde which caused timing problems on slower machines
(see pkg/16071). Instead, delete the kded module files so that kdeinit
falls back to exec(3)ing the binary.

(bye bye sed script)
2002-03-28 08:57:38 +00:00
markd
b845908797 Cause a newline to be added to kio/klauncher/Makefile.am before patch is run
so that patch on Solaris succeeds with patch-bk.
2002-03-15 04:09:14 +00:00
fredb
b48eba1112 Give all packages which depend on "png" a version bump, and update
all dependencies on packages depending on "png" which contain shared
libraries, all for the (imminent) update to the "png" package.
[List courtesy of John Darrow, courtesy of "bulk-build".]
2002-03-13 17:36:35 +00:00
skrll
5f42d5addd Make sure that kssl look in the right place for its data.
This fixes the "The server certificate failed the authenticity test"
errors in konqueror when using https.
2002-02-23 15:24:17 +00:00
skrll
53060a8fe0 Pull in gcc-2.95.3 for alpha as kdeprint/management/kmiconview.cpp
tickles a compiler bug.
2002-02-15 09:26:32 +00:00
skrll
4f2c8debec Fix the mimelnk/application/x-core.desktop pattern.
Closes pkg/15172 from Hume Smith <hclsmith@yahoo.ca>
2002-01-25 19:28:11 +00:00
skrll
e2085318bc Make sure we've got a version of libxml2 that the configure script is
happy with. Reported by Chris Gilbert.
2002-01-21 12:11:16 +00:00
tron
c4db0bc0ad Use new format for "UNLIMIT_RESOURCES". 2002-01-05 06:47:00 +00:00
tron
0c72662d8c Unlimit datasize for building which is necessary for the new toolchain. 2002-01-04 12:06:08 +00:00
zuntum
47c3ac6157 Set BUILDLINK_DEPENDS.qt2-libs to qt2-libs>=2.3.0
(similarly to recent Makefile change)
2001-12-30 23:32:24 +00:00
zuntum
074e87bad3 Depend on qt2-libs>=2.3.0, not "2.2.4" (default of qt2-libs's buildlink.mk)
PR pkg/13290 by Scott Presnell <srp@zgi.com>
2001-12-30 11:54:11 +00:00
tron
e8844fb09b Remove support for dynamic package list handling because "USE_CUPS" only
affects the "kdelibs2" package.
2001-12-20 12:09:50 +00:00
tron
cec61e6da1 Add automatic package list handling required for "USE_CUPS". 2001-12-19 15:29:28 +00:00
tron
576becf404 Include "cups" buildlink glue code only if "USE_CUPS" is set to "YES". 2001-12-19 14:20:46 +00:00
jlam
9efcd64075 Since print/cups conflicts with another popular print package,
print/lprng, we make a new variable USE_CUPS that is used by packages to
determine whether depend on print/cups and to compile in support for CUPS.
USE_CUPS may be either "YES" or undefined.  Deprecate SAMBA_WITH_CUPS as
its purpose is superseded by USE_CUPS.  Convert net/samba and net/samba20
to use USE_CUPS and make x11/kdelibs2 respect USE_CUPS.
2001-12-18 20:22:59 +00:00
skrll
bf01551eea Fix compilation on a.out platforms. 2001-12-16 20:33:40 +00:00
skrll
49151ede49 Be more careful when using QCString in meinproc... This avoids at least on
SEGV I've seen still looking for the others.
2001-12-10 10:02:53 +00:00
skrll
a334152dde Remove an old (commented out) DEPENDS line. 2001-12-07 10:59:31 +00:00
jlam
eb8f266f51 Use perl5/buildlink.mk instead of USE_PERL5, and supply a definition for
BUILDLINK_KDEDIR to fix a harmless error when building kdelibs2 where
-L/lib appeared as a flag to the compiler/linker.
2001-12-07 07:22:47 +00:00
skrll
41310893f8 Oops, these patches still exist. 2001-12-04 11:06:05 +00:00
skrll
a100f5d455 Update to KDE 2.2.2
Closes pkg/14728 from Mark Davies <mark@mcs.vuw.ac.nz>. Changes from him
with updates from myself.

From www.kde.org... The principal improvements over KDE 2.2.1, release two
months ago, include:

o security-related
	- SSL certificate loading
	- symlink vulnerability in .wmrc access by KDM introduced in 2.2
	- security problem with eFax (used by klprfax)
	- potential problem in PAM invocation by KDM
	- potential harmful side-effect of failed KDM session starts

o new features
	- added support for CodeWeavers' CrossOver plug-in (provides support
	  for QuickTime, etc.)
	- added support for the wheelmouse for scrolling through the
	  KGhostview PS/PDF viewer component
	- ability to search for multiple patterns at a time in the file
	  search dialog
	- debugging multi-threaded applications with KDevelop

o improvements/fixes
	- handling of HTTP links that redirect to FTP
	- POST using SSL through a proxy and sending headers through proxies
	- saving of recently-selected files in the file dialog
	- handling of non-ASCII characters over SMB
	- toolbar button captions with certain styles
	- selecting items with the mouse in Konqueror
	- sorting in Konqueror's textview
	- saving current settings as a theme in the theme manager
	- crashes in KMail with certain mails
	- crash on invoking the KDM chooser
	- non-Latin languages with KDevelop

performance
	- icon loading optimized
	- file dialog speedups
	- stop spinning SMB client processes
	- handling of large files in Kate
2001-12-03 15:37:14 +00:00
jlam
ed4a811bd9 Fix build problems with packages that use artsc-config. The -I option was
being improperly translated by buildlink.  This should fix pkg/14306 by
Kent Polk <kpolk@darwin.sfbr.org>.
2001-11-19 17:48:08 +00:00
skrll
71515ea470 Fix the PASV response decode in kio_ftp as reported in pkg/13344. This
is in line with rfc1123 sec 4.1.2.6.

Fix the search method for lib{ssl,crypto} in kopenssl.cc
2001-11-17 12:01:34 +00:00
jlam
a161e2da9c Remove headers and libraries that need not be symlinked into
${BUILDLINK_DIR} as they're not required for building purposes.
2001-11-16 02:03:27 +00:00
jlam
891ea7f550 Revert last change...the kio_ldap.* files are part of kdebase2, not
kdelibs2.
2001-11-15 21:00:27 +00:00
tron
f64441dd18 Include buildlink code of "openldap" package to get LDAP support not only
by accident.
2001-11-15 11:33:13 +00:00
jlam
b32cb3436e kdelibs/Makefile now needs a KDEDIR setting since it's no longer set by
kde2/buildlink.mk.
2001-11-14 20:29:43 +00:00
jlam
befb2d2650 * Strongly buildinkify.
* Manage all of the icon directories for all of the KDE2 packages in the
  PLIST.
* Workaround a NetBSD/alpha egcs optimization bug.
* Allow artsdsp pre-loadable module to be built.
* Fix pkg/14430 by Mark Davies <mark@mcs.vuw.ac.nz> where mounting devices
  from KDE2 when /sbin isn't in your path doesn't work because mount/umount
  can't be found.  We append /sbin:/usr/sbin to the path before calling
  mount/umount.
* Properly recognize that NetBSD's OSS implementation doesn't include the
  Linux MIDI interface.
* Fix and sort PLIST.
2001-11-13 21:09:07 +00:00
tron
83acc39777 Adapt to new directory layout. 2001-11-01 18:32:02 +00:00
zuntum
d3db18607d Move pkg/ files into package's toplevel directory 2001-10-31 22:03:21 +00:00
skrll
9f28ffc95e Update REPLACE_PERL to work for /bin/perl and use it in kdelibs2 instead
of home grown post-patch target.
2001-10-26 13:57:58 +00:00
skrll
a62b3e67a6 Update to KDE 2.2.1
With apologies to Al I wouldn't know where to start with a summary of the
changes between 2.1 and 2.2.1 - there are just too many. A couple of
hopefully static URLS that contain useful information are

http://www.kde.org/announcements/changelog2_1to2_2.html
http://www.kde.org/announcements/changelog2_2to2_2_1.html

Support for a.out for kde{libs,base} added by me. The libtool/a.out
combination doesn't like the linking of modules into binaries. A better
way of doing this will appear in future versions of KDE/pkgsrc.
2001-10-15 22:45:55 +00:00
jlam
f0a4fcd3e4 Substitute the real config script for the config wrapper script in
installed files.  We don't want buildlink references to escape into the
install directory.
2001-10-03 20:56:40 +00:00
skrll
ac1cf195d6 Allow overriding of MASTER_SITES and do so for kdelibs - the distribution
tarball is in its own directory.
2001-09-22 10:45:09 +00:00
jdolecek
c0e7cc2d9e kdelibs2 work just okay with libaudiofile 0.1.9, don't need more
current version
2001-09-21 20:16:18 +00:00
drochner
6dc8a40afc update to 2.1.2
This release provides the following fixes:

Security fixes:
 KDEsu. The KDEsu which shipped with earlier releases of
  KDE 2 writes a (very) temporary but world-readable file
  with authentication information. A local user can
  potentially abuse this behavior to gain access to the X
  server and, if KDEsu is used to perform tasks that require
  root-access, can result in comprimise of the root account.
Bug fixes:
 kio_http. Fixed problems with "protocol for http://x.y.z
  died unexpectedly" and with proxy authentication with
  Konqueror.
 kparts. Fixed crash in KOffice 1.1 when splitting views.
  khtml. Fixed memory leak in Konqueror. Fixed minor
  HTML rendering problems.
 kcookiejar. Fixed minor problems with HTTP cookies.
  kconfig. Fixed problem with leading/trailing spaces in
  configuration values.
 kdebug. Fixed memory leak in debug output.
  klineedit. Fixed problem with klineedit emitting "return
  pressed" twice.

(The security fix was already dealt with by patches.)
2001-09-07 14:32:21 +00:00
drochner
dad337d577 change dependencies to kdexxx>=2.1 instead of strict matches
to ease updates
2001-09-07 14:27:10 +00:00
jlam
7bba3453dc If USE_CONFIG_WRAPPER is defined (implied by USE_BUILDLINK_ONLY), then
set FOO_CONFIG=${BUILDLINK_CONFIG_WRAPPER.foo} in both CONFIGURE_ENV and
MAKE_ENV.  We remove the check for GNU_CONFIGURE because if a package
Makefile includes the buildlink.mk file, then it most likely wants to use
the config script wrappers as well.  Change suggested by Hubert Feyrer
(hubertf) and Tomasz Luchowski (zuntum).
2001-08-17 21:14:00 +00:00
jlam
d2eb68d2a6 Add dir_DEFAULT setting used by EVAL_PREFIX logic to set the default
installation directory in case the package isn't installed.
2001-07-27 13:33:18 +00:00